The 'Mini Robo Vacuum' Sucks Up Crumbs, Leaves Cuteness
File it under Too Cute For Words: the Mini Robo Vacuum will cheerily suck up the mess from your desk or kitchen table. With the push of a button on top of his head (yes, I gendered the vacuum), this little guy will make quick work of crumbs.
No, he’s not going to suck the microbes out of your tablecloth like a Dyson. But in this economy, twenty bucks worth of clever and cute will get you pretty far. Beware, office mates! You may see a new friend zooming around soon.
It’s another brilliant offering from Fred Flare, who has been generating 70% of the world’s kitch from its NYC locale since 1998.
